In working with Trauma and PTSD, I employ a trauma-informed and patient-centered approach. This involves creating a safe therapeutic space where individuals can explore and process their traumatic experiences. Techniques such as Prolonged Exposure (PE), Cognitive Processing Therapy (CPT), Written Exposure Therapy (WET), Skills Training in Affective and Interpersonal Regulation (STAIR), and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T) may be used to address symptoms and promote healing. The focus is on helping individuals regain a sense of control, manage triggers, address avoidance, and work towards building a foundation for long-term recovery.
